Ylijännitteisiin refers to overvoltages, which are electrical potentials that exceed the normal operating level of a system. These events can be transient or sustained and can have damaging effects on electrical equipment. Transient overvoltages are short-lived but can reach very high magnitudes, often caused by lightning strikes or the switching of electrical loads. Sustained overvoltages are longer-lasting and occur when the voltage remains above the rated level for an extended period, typically due to faults in the power system or issues with voltage regulation.
